Output dac62e011f0c92ef47d631e7335bdd32fa3842afb0d77c48d2c07ad0d74a9d58:15

value
40994
script pubkey
OP_0 OP_PUSHBYTES_20 90635037a7adb7b7d0a954023b9e565e247be360
address
bc1qjp34qda84kmm059f2sprh8jktcj8hcmqfkh5yp
transaction
dac62e011f0c92ef47d631e7335bdd32fa3842afb0d77c48d2c07ad0d74a9d58
confirmations
139103
spent
true